Vitamins – Important for maintaining body functions



Vitamins are the nutrients that our body needs in order to maintain functions such as immunity and metabolism. They are water soluble and fat soluble and are the most important parts of our body. Fat soluble vitamins are stored in fat cells of the body. On the other hand, water soluble vitamins are not stored in our body. Our body takes it from the food we eat and then excrete what is not needed as waste. Water soluble vitamins can be destroyed while they are cooked. So, care should be taken while cooking them.

Fat soluble vitamins include vitamin A, Vitamin D, Vitamin K and Vitamin E. Water soluble vitamins include Thiamin, Riboflavin, Niacin, B6,B12, Biotin , Folic acid, Pantothenic acid and Vitamin C.

Chemistry of natural products By Eric Ittah

A natural product is a substance produced by a living organism. It is found in nature and is considered a major source for drug discovery. A natural compound is used mainly for treating many life threatening conditions. It is obtained from tissues of terrestrial plants, marine organisms and from microorganisms.  Today, there are many medicines that are obtained directly from natural products. They have been a fertile area of chemical research and experiments from many long years. 

Natural products can be classified into four major categories. A large number of these products are obtained from microorganisms. Many terrestrial and marine microorganisms have been screened for drug discovery. These organisms are chosen for extraction of natural products because they have a wide variety of potentially active substances. Even marine organisms contribute a lot because they synthesize many complex chemicals that act as possible remedies for a number of ailments.

Lipids – Important Part of Living Cells By Eric Ittah



Lipids are critically important to the structure and function of human body. Every cell of human body contains lipids and virtually all body functions directly or indirectly involves lipids. There are many types of lipids found in our body. Some of them include cholesterol, triglycerides and steroids.  Any imbalance or excesses in this substance can lead to disease.

One of the most important lipids found in human body is Cholesterol. It is manufactured in liver to meet the requirement of body. It is a lipid that serves as a major building block for the body. It also serves as a base chemical for vitamin D synthesis. It does not dissolve in water and binds to carrier proteins to travel in blood.
